What happens when a fifteen year old girl is left in London by her parents and has no idea where they are? Begging her Aunt to tell her, slowly putting clues together and receiving support from a boy that has made her heart make skips and leaps like never before, read to find out what happens to this abandoned girl, and why it was the best choice her parents could make. ~Sample~ (from chapter 7) "Shut the hell up or I will shoot you," I hear the guy say. What the devil is going on? Kill Rachel? Why? "What she ever did do you, huh?" I shout fiercly into the phone. "Don't effing shoot her! You-you," I nearly let a swear word slip out of my mouth, which I hate doing. And I know that if I said it, it would make things worse. Then I hear the phone being picked up from probably having fallen onto the floor. "I don't know who you are girl, but your friend here was invading our privacy. I was just visiting these good old lawyers. Well, to be completely honest, I will tell you something. We are the Weeders and we were born to kill the people who get in our way." The deep, raspy voice I have been hearing all along says in a much more sinister and clearer way. He hangs up.
